>  > Running PC with Cubase 4 here. Apart from the TM-1, I have a Midex8 and a
>  > Midisport 2x2 (only for keeping the NordModular editor trafic off the
>  > Midex8...).
>  >
>  > After a cold boot/restart of my computer, the C6 utility will more often
>  > than not select the wrong midi port, so I usually have to configure that
>  > again, and restart the C6 utility for it to work. That doesn't seem to
>  > happen when I use the Midex8 for connectiong to the MD.
>  >
>  > Cubase, on the other hand seem to be able to keep track of which 
> interface
>  >
>  > is the TM-1. However, sometimes during start of Cubase, or during
>  > playback,
>  > cubase just freezes, until I unplug the TM-1, then everything goes
>  > straight
>  > back to normal (happends both during startup, shutdown and sometimes
>  > during
>  > playback in Cubase 4, and during startup in SX3).
>  >
>  > Also, with TM-1, having cubase running and using C6 at the same time
>  > doesn't
>  > work (since the windows driver doesn't allow multiple apps to use the 
> same
>  >
>  > port simultaneously). This works just fine with the Midex8.
>  >
>  > All in all, I have just decided to disconnect the TM-1, and go back to
>  > having the MD connected to the Midex8. The very quick dumps adn sample
>  > loads
>  > were great, but all in all, with the problems I'm having, it's not worth
>  > it...
>  >
>  > Anybody else with similar setups experiencing similar problems?
